  Let's Talk on April 29th
 
                     
 
The Cuyahoga Falls community invites you to a program aimed at starting the conversation about teen opiate use on Wednesday, April 29th, from 5:00pm - 8:00pm at the High School. 
 The program will feature a keynote by Robby's Voice, a resource fair, the Hidden in Plain Sight  display, and a variety of topical breakout sessions. Participants are asked to bring unwanted, outdated or unused prescriptions so that the Cuyahoga Falls Police can properly dispose of them. 

This is a free event which is open to the public. An event flyer is available here and registration is now open.

Postpartum Support International Perinatal Mood and Anxiety Disorder Training 

   

This two-day training on May 7-8, 2015 will focus on the assessment and treatment of women experiencing perinatal mood and anxiety disorders. Registration information and a flyer are now available.
